Commence-ment Date means the earlier to occur of (i) the date the Premises are ready for occupancy or (ii) the date Tenant takes occupancy of the Premises. The Premises shall be deemed ready for occupancy on the first day as of which ▇▇▇▇▇▇'S work as delineated on Exhibit "B", attached hereto and made a part hereof, has been completed except for items of work (and, if applicable, adjustment and fixtures) which can be completed after occupancy has been taken, without causing undue interference with ▇▇▇▇▇▇'S use of the Premises (i.e., so-called "punch list" items) and LESSEE has been given notice thereof. LESSOR shall complete as soon as conditions permit, all "punch list" items and LESSEE shall afford LESSOR access to the Premises for such purposes. Notwithstanding the foregoing, if Tenant's personnel shall occupy all or any part of the Premises for the conduct of its business prior to the Commencement Date as determined herein, such date of occupancy shall, for all intents and purposes of this Lease, be the Commencement Date. Landlord and Tenant agree to execute a Supplemental Agreement setting forth the actual Occupancy and Term Dates, once the same have been established.
